The New Zealand handicraft market is projected to experience a compound annual growth rate of 1.67% from 2025 to 2031, reflecting a gradual increase in demand driven by evolving consumer preferences and cultural appreciation for artisanal products. The anticipated growth trajectory, starting with minimal expansion in 2025 and accelerating to 2.44% by 2031, suggests that supply chain dynamics will play a crucial role in shaping this market. As input costs fluctuate due to global supply chain disruptions and raw material availability, producers may face challenges that could impact pricing strategies and profit margins. Additionally, the reliance on imported materials for handicrafts may introduce volatility linked to international trade policies and currency exchange rates. Consequently, while the market will likely benefit from rising consumer interest, the interplay of these macroeconomic factors will be pivotal in determining the sustainability of growth within this sector.
